📝 Color Information for #DBAEA4

The hexadecimal color code #DBAEA4 represents a light shade in the red family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 219 red, 174 green, and 164 blue, which translates to approximately 86% red, 68% green, and 64% blue. This makes it a slightly desaturated color with warm und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#DBAEA4 has a hue of 11 degrees, a saturation level of 43%, and a lightness value of 75%. The hue angle of 11° places this color firmly in the red sp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 11°, saturation of 25%, and brightness/value of 86%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#DBAEA4 would be reproduced using 0% cyan, 21% magenta, 25% yellow, and 14% black. The closest web-safe color is #CC9999,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. As a lighter shade, it's excellent for backgrounds, negative space, and creating a sense of openness in designs. The moderate to low saturation gives this color a sophisticated, muted quality that works well in professional and minimalist designs. When pairing #DBAEA4 with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 191°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 14397092,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#DBAEA4? +

The approximate CMYK value of #DBAEA4 is C:0% M:21% Y:25% K:14%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
